This is needed so that callers would not get 'context imbalance' warnings from the sparse tool.
As a side effect, this patch fixes the following sparse warnings:
CHECK mm/oom_kill.c mm/oom_kill.c:201:28: warning: context imbalance in 'oom_badness' - unexpected unlock include/linux/rcupdate.h:249:30: warning: context imbalance in 'dump_tasks' - unexpected unlock mm/oom_kill.c:453:9: warning: context imbalance in 'oom_kill_task' - unexpected unlock CHECK mm/memcontrol.c ... mm/memcontrol.c:1130:17: warning: context imbalance in 'task_in_mem_cgroup' - unexpected unlock
